For more than ten years, many people from Ethiopia's eastern Ogaden region have been battling for an autonomous state.
It is a hidden war that has seen many women take up arms.
Al Jazeera was given exclusive access to Ogaden.
Mohammed Adow has more on the fighters from the Ogaden National Liberation Front.

Zimbabwe - a country paralyzed by political uncertainty and now caught in the midst of a wave of post election violence.
The opposition claims at least 10 people have been killed and hundreds have been injured, mostly during what they say has been a campaign of intimidation by supporters of Robert Mugabe.
It is a claim his ruling ZANU-PF party has denied.

This week on One on One, meet young Sudanese hip-hop singer and activist Emmanuel Jal. Aged only seven, he became a child soldier sent from Sudan to fight in Ethiopia's brutal war. Through a lot of luck and determination, he managed to turn his life around, becoming one of Africa's hottest music stars.
